This journal utilizes several national resources such as the Indonesian Scientific Journal Database (ISJD), Garba Digital Reference (Garuda), and the Indonesian Journal Volunteer system as the basis for developing a distributed archiving system. This system is designed to be implemented among participating libraries, with the aim of creating a collaborative network in terms of sustainable management and storage of scientific journals. Through this approach, each participating library is authorized to form a permanent archive of its scientific journal collection. This not only functions as a form of support for efforts to preserve scientific documents, but also as a strategic step in ensuring the long-term availability and accessibility of national scientific publications. In addition, this system also has the potential to facilitate the data restoration process in the event of damage or loss of archives in the future.
